    Scenic City: The Go Lite Bed Deck is just an idea. That's the great part of the GFC: everyone has a different solution in their mind. That said, I think there may be a Graeme/Wiley potential Go Lite Bed Deck that is a better solution than mine. The product I used is OK, I'm pretty happy with prototype 1, but next gen will better I bet. I forgot to show the panel that converts to a table (25x57) if you need it. Wolf pack stairs to get into the bed.F600263F-01FB-44B7-9E1F-D74E0F483321.jpg
    Tonered: I put a duplicate bed rail for additional support and for securing my mtn bike. Then I used a couple 3/16" pins to secure it. I went Den to Bozeman without a topper and it rode great. These two pics are in the stealth bike mode and it uses one pin in front. With the L shape (16x57) panel I use 2 pins. Locks right in. I use a 1" tie across the wolf packs for insurance.
    Simple solutions are best IMO.AA1A317A-273D-42A3-B382-8E24319BA97D.jpgE509C942-74E7-43CE-9438-9717C4EA006B.jpg

    I also used a couple pins per wolf pack through the 25x57 panel and a non structural part of the WP;they seem to work great. Thats my solution anyway.IMG_0307.jpg
